3 Easy Patriotic Recipes 

1. Patriotic Graham Cracker Ice Cream Sandwiches by Courtney @thechirpingmoms 

Ingredients: 
– Vanilla ice cream
– Graham crackers
– Star sprinkles (or any red, white & blue sprinkles)
 
Instructions:
Start by breaking the graham crackers in half so you have all squares. While you are doing that, let your vanilla ice cream sit out and soften a little. Scoop ice cream onto a graham cracker square. Gently press another graham cracker on top to make an ice cream sandwich. Cover all 4 sides of the sandwich with star sprinkles. Put back into the freezer to let the ice cream harden and the sprinkles really stick. Enjoy! 
 

2. Patriotic Popsicles by Casey @homeandhallow

Ingredients:

– 1 cup strawberries
– 1 cup blueberries
– 1 cup vanilla yogurt
– 2 tablespoons sugar (optional; add 1-2 tablespoons each to the strawberries and blueberries for desired sweetness)
– water 
 
Instructions:
1. Using a small food processor or blender, puree the blueberries (and optional sugar) until smooth. (You can add a few drops of blue food coloring if your blueberry puree looks purple). Add water, a few tablespoons at at time, and stir until the consistency of the blueberry mixture is thin enough to easily pour. 
2. Pour thinned blueberry puree into the bottom third of each popsicle mold. Freeze for at least twenty minutes (or until layer is solid) before adding the next layer to prevent the layers from mixing together. 
3. Put vanilla yogurt in a small bowl and add water a few tablespoons at time. Add enough water to thin the yogurt to a consistency that it easily pours. Stir until well combined.
4. Pour the thinned yogurt mixture into the middle third of the popsicle molds. 
5. Insert popsicle sticks into each popsicle mold and freeze for at least twenty minutes before adding the next layer. 
6. Puree the strawberries (and optional sugar) until smooth. Add enough water until the consistency of the strawberry mixture is thin enough to easily pour. 
7. Fill the last third of the popsicle molds with the strawberry mixture. 
8. Freeze overnight or until completely frozen solid. 
 
To remove popsicles from mold: Fill a large bowl with warm (not hot) water. Immerse the mold just up to the lip in the warm water. Hold for 5-10 seconds, remove, and try to pull the popsicles out. If they don’t easily slide out, immerse again and repeat as needed. 
 
 
 
 

3. Star Shaped Rice Krispee Treat Wands by Lauren @laur_diamantes

Do you have a favorite festive treat you grew up loving? The one thing that reminded you of a holiday and hold many memories. I remember my mom always making rice krispee treats and changing the shape or sprinkles to coordinate with the holiday. It’s a super easy treat that can’t be messed up and your children will love to make them with you, be prepared for some sticky fingers though.

5 minute rice krispee treats
Ingredients:
1 stick of unsalted butter
16oz mini marshmallow bag
8 cups of rice krispee cereal
Nonstick spray
9×13 baking pan (we use glass pyrex)
Nonstick spatula
Wax paper
Decorative sprinkles

Instructions:
Grease baking dish/pan
Measure out 8 cups of rice krispee cereal and set aside in a bowl
Melt butter in a microwave safe bowl
Add marshmallows to melted butter bowl, microwave for 1 minute
Stir mixture then microwave for 30 seconds
Stir mixture then pour onto rice krispees
Coat all cereal in bowl then pour into pan
Add sprinkles on top then press down with wax paper into pan to shape
Refrigerate for an hour

To make a star:
Add a shape to rice krispees
Take out of refrigerator after an hour
Push cookie cuter shape into the pan

To make into a wand
Add a wooden dowel and ribbon
Dowels are from Target
Ribbon is all satin and from Target as well
Cut into different lengths and widths for dimension
Fold over bottom of ribbon, cut diagonal up for a pretty look
Tie ribbon around dowel
Stick in dowel
Wah-la a magical edible wand
